Rick Henderson – Associate Vice President of University Advancement & Philanthropic Campaigns, Sacred Heart University
For Richard “Rick” Henderson, helping others find their true potential has always been his calling. A veteran of educational institutions, Henderson has dedicated much of his professional life to philanthropy and helping schools provide support to their most crucial stakeholders: students.
In his new role as Associate Vice President of University Advancement & Philanthropic Campaigns for the Pioneer community, he will support students in a variety of new ways, through the development of fundraising campaigns, the cultivation of donor relationships and the oversight of strategic giving initiatives. Engaging with Sacred Heart’s alumni, parents, friends and corporate partners will be an important opportunity. The University is dedicated to increasing the philanthropic resources for its most deserving students.
Before joining SHU, Henderson worked in advancement at Choate Rosemary Hall, Fairfield Prep and most recently the Canterbury School.
